What You'll Do

As an EPM Architect on this team, you will serve as a trusted advisor to the customers, providing expert mentorship on Oracle EPM Cloud solutions. You will drive discussions to identify gaps and challenges to help craft and define customer EPM requirements and visions. You will lead the entire project lifecycle, from requirement gathering and solution design to guiding the development team and convincing the customer to adopt the appropriate processes and tools. You will work independently on development and issue resolution, ensure timely delivery of project artifacts, and provide comprehensive support throughout the implementation, coordinating closely with the customer, internal team, and product support to drive the successful deployment of the EPM solution. You will be responsible for post production delivery as well.

Minimum Qualifications

  • Bachelor in Computer Science or Computer Engineering with Finance/Accounting background
  • 10+ years of EPM consulting and implementation experience in EPM cloud products
  • Worked on 4 end-to-end implementations in any two EPM cloud products (EPBS Modules, FCCS, ARCS, and NR)
  • Deep functional knowledge of financial processes and associated functionality in the EPM area
  • Expertise in developing custom integrations using EPM Data Integration, EPM Integration Agent, Pipeline, Groovy Business Rule, and EPM Automate
  • Hands-on knowledge of scripting (Batch/Python/PowerShell)
  • Strong problem-solving skills
  • Ability to work in a fast-paced environment and master unfamiliar concepts quickly with little supervision
  • Willing to go on-site at local customer on need basis

Preferred Qualifications

  • Excellent communication, project/stakeholder/team management skills, and experience
  • Knowledge of SRs, RFCs, and My Oracle Support
  • Knowledge of OAC-Essbase, Essbase 19c and Essbase 21c
  • Strong customer focus, excellent problem-solving and analytical skills
